
Introduction:
Slow Cooker Chocolate Turtles offer a rich and indulgent treat, perfect for those with a sweet tooth! This easy, no-bake recipe combines the delightful flavors of caramel, pecans, and chocolate, giving you a sweet, chewy, and crunchy snack that will impress friends and family alike. The best part? It’s all made in the slow cooker, saving you time and hassle. These chocolate turtles make for the ideal gift or a simple yet satisfying dessert after any meal.
Ingredients:
24 pecan halves
24 caramel candies (wrapped)
1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 tablespoon butter
1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
